кашљати

“кашљати” (kašljati) — to cough in Serbian. Verb, level A1. In the present the soft lj shows up everywhere: kasljem, kasljes. The noun kasalj is already learned. In a live sentence: “Кашљем већ недељу дана” — I have been coughing for a week. You can hear how it sounds right here. Written with the characters к, а, ш, љ, а, т, и.
